Other nuts (excluding wild edible nuts and groundnuts), in shell in Albania
Albania: Other nuts (excluding wild edible nuts and groundnuts), in shell was 40,629 1000 USD in 2024. ▲ Rising
Other nuts (excluding wild edible nuts and groundnuts), in shell in Albania, 1961–2024
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in 1000 USD.
Analysis
In 2024, other nuts (excluding wild edible nuts and groundnuts), in shell in Albania stood at 40,629 1000 USD.
The figure is down 1.0% on the previous year and up 41.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, other nuts (excluding wild edible nuts and groundnuts), in shell in Albania peaked at 41,019 1000 USD in 2023 and was at its lowest, 8,979 1000 USD, in 1990.
That places Albania 11th out of 46 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 62 years of available data.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
